People Details: Rewards

Overview

Rewards refer to different assets (such as Gift Cards, Badges, or Coupons, for example) that customers can redeem by spending their points. When a customer redeems a Reward, the platform creates a new asset called a Redemption that contains the details and metadata of the Reward.

The Rewards tab displays all of the Redemptions for this customer.

 Approve or Reject a Redemption

If a Redemption's approval status is still "Submitted," you can approve or reject the Redemption. The possible approval status values are:

  • Submitted: The customer has submitted the Redemption, but it is not yet accepted or rejected.

  • Approved: The Redemption has been approved, either manually by a Marketer or automatically with the auto-approve feature.

  • Rejected: The Redemption has been rejected by a Marketer and is ineligible to receive the Reward. You must manually reject a response. You can send a message to the customer regarding the rejection and give him or her the opportunity to re-submit a response.

  • Returned: The Redemption has been rejected, but the customer has the opportunity to re-submit a response.

To approve or reject the Redemption:

  1. From the "Action" drop-down menu, select "Approve" or "Reject."

 

 Edit a Redemption

To edit a Redemption:

  1. From the "Action" menu next to the desired Redemption, select "Edit." The "Update Processing Status" pop-up window is displayed.

  2. Optionally, from the "Processing Status" drop-down menu, select the desired status.

  3. Optionally, from the "Activity Processed" drop-down menu, select either "Yes" or "No."

  4. Click save.
